Been using Surfshark for a while now, so figured I’d share my experience since I keep seeing people asking about it.
Biggest thing for me is the unlimited devices. I have it on my PC, phone and laptop and don’t have to think about how many devices are connected, even shared my acc with a friend.
The apps are neat, easy to use, and the design is pretty sleek too (although obviously that’s subjective). Speeds have generally been good as well.
Is Surfshark good for torrenting? I’ve used it for torrents without any major issues. Surfshark supports P2P, and it also has a kill switch, which I always turn on before torrenting.
For normal use, I mostly just connect to a nearby server and forget it’s running. CleanWeb is useful for blocking some ads and trackers. I also like the split tunneling feature because you can choose which apps go through the VPN and which ones use your normal connection. So if I want my browser on the VPN but don’t want another app slowed down or routed through it, I can just exclude that app. It’s a really useful feature actually.
As for the downsides? The month-to-month price isn’t great, basically it only makes sense to get the longer plan for a fraction of the cost. I’ve also occasionally had a server that felt slower than usual and had to switch locations. But that’s happened with pretty much every VPN I’ve tried, so I don’t see it as some major Surfshark-specific problem.
